피드로 돌아가기
Dev.toFrontend
원문 읽기
Next.js와 Firebase 기반 SEO 최적화로 지역 기반 쿠폰 플랫폼 구축
How I Built a Hyperlocal Coupon Platform with Next.js Firebase for Small-Town India
AI 요약
Context
인도 중소 도시 상점들의 디지털 전환 부재와 대형 플랫폼의 서비스 공백으로 인한 로컬 마켓 진입 필요성 대두. 검색 엔진 노출 최적화와 빠른 페이지 로딩 속도 확보가 사업 성패를 결정짓는 핵심 제약 사항으로 작용.
Technical Solution
- 검색 엔진 인덱싱 극대화를 위한 Next.js SSR 및 ISR 기반의 동적 랜딩 페이지 구조 설계
- Browser 단의 JavaScript 번들 크기 감소 및 Core Web Vitals 개선을 위한 React Server Components 기반 Firestore 데이터 페칭 구현
- Google Featured Snippets 노출을 위한 JSON-LD 구조화 데이터 및 동적 sitemap.xml 자동 생성 로직 적용
- 쿠폰 부정 사용 방지를 위해 User ID와 매핑된 Unique Coupon Code 생성 및 Firestore Sub-collection 계층 구조 설계
- Cloud Run UTC 환경과 인도 표준시(IST) 간의 시차로 인한 만료 시간 오류를 해결하기 위한 타임존 오프셋 보정 로직 구현
실천 포인트
1. 지역 기반 서비스 설계 시 ISR을 통한 동적 메타데이터 생성 전략 검토
2. Server Components를 활용한 클라이언트 사이드 SDK 의존성 제거 및 LCP 최적화 수행
3. 분산 환경의 서버 타임존과 사용자 로컬 타임존 간의 일치 여부 검증 로직 필수 포함
4. 데이터 무결성 확보를 위한 Unique ID 기반의 1:1 매핑 검증 구조 설계